Park chairs are exposed to various weather conditions, including acid rain, which can cause significant damage over time. To prevent corrosion and deterioration, manufacturers use several protective measures.

First, park chairs are often made from weather-resistant materials such as aluminum, stainless steel, or specially treated wood. These materials naturally resist rust and decay. Additionally, metal chairs are coated with powder coatings or galvanized finishes, creating a barrier against moisture and acidic elements.

Another method involves using plastic or composite materials, which are inherently resistant to acid rain. These materials do not corrode and require minimal maintenance. For wooden chairs, sealants and water-repellent stains are applied to protect the surface from moisture absorption and chemical damage.

Regular maintenance, such as cleaning and reapplying protective coatings, further extends the lifespan of park chairs. By combining durable materials and proactive care, park chairs remain functional and aesthetically pleasing despite exposure to acid rain.
